What Is a Magnetic USB Cable and How Does It Work?
A magnetic USB cable uses magnets to assist mating while conductive contacts transfer electrical power and, in some designs, data between the cable and device. This guide explains how magnetic USB cables work, how pogo pin versions are structured, what magnets actually do, and what engineers should consider for charging, data, breakaway behavior, wear, contamination and custom cable design.
